Northrop Grumman is a global aerospace and defense technology leader that designs and builds advanced weapons, cyber‑security systems, and space platforms. The company’s innovations drive national security and commercial space exploration.
Positions range from software engineers and systems architects to cybersecurity analysts, data scientists, and program managers. Candidates work on classified and commercial projects, often in multidisciplinary teams, and benefit from competitive pay, comprehensive benefits, and continuous learning opportunities.

Sentinel Nuclear Surety Systems Engineer (T2) -13783*
Company: Northrop Grumman
Location: Roy, UT
Posted Nov 20, 2024
Northrop Grumman is seeking a Nuclear Surety Systems Engineer for a position in Roy, Utah. The role involves working on the Sentinel program, ensuring nuclear weapons are protected against threats. Key responsibilities include decomposition of safety manuals into requirements, systems engineering expertise for a next-gen ICBM weapon system, and interfacing with DoD and DoE for safe design and operation of nuclear weapon systems. Benefits include a competitive salary, robust benefits package, and opportunities for professional growth. Requirements include a STEM degree, DoD Secret Clearance, and experience in systems engineering or nuclear surety.
